What are Piles, Fissure, and Fistula?
Piles (Hemorrhoids), fissures, and fistulas are common anorectal conditions that affect many individuals.
- Piles are swollen blood vessels in the rectal or anal region, often resulting from excessive straining during bowel movements.
- Fissures are small tears or cracks in the anal lining that cause sharp pain and bleeding during defecation.
- Fistulas are abnormal tunnels connecting the inside of the anus or rectum to the skin around the anus, typically caused by an infection or abscess.

Statistics of Piles, Fissure, and Fistula in India
- Approximately 40% of the Indian population experiences anorectal disorders at some point in their lives.
- Piles affect around 10 million Indians annually, with prevalence higher in adults aged 45 and above.
- Anal fissures account for 15-20% of all anorectal complaints reported to doctors.
- Anal fistulas, though less common, affect 2-4 people per 10,000 annually, often leading to recurrent infections and discomfort.

Symptoms of Piles, Fissure, and Fistula
Piles
- Pain or discomfort during bowel movements
- Bleeding (bright red blood) in stools
- Itching or irritation near the anus
- Swelling or lump around the anus
Fissure
- Severe pain during and after defecation
- Bleeding (small amounts on toilet paper)
- Visible crack or tear near the anus
- Spasms in the anal sphincter
Fistula
- Persistent pain and swelling near the anus
- Pus or blood discharge from an opening around the anus
- Fever and malaise in case of infection
- Recurring abscesses

Prevention Tips for Piles, Fissure, and Fistula
- Maintain a fiber-rich diet with fruits, vegetables, and whole grains.
- Stay hydrated by drinking plenty of water daily.
- Avoid straining during bowel movements.
- Exercise regularly to improve digestion and prevent constipation.
- Avoid prolonged sitting, especially on hard surfaces.
- Maintain proper hygiene in the anal region to prevent infections.
- Treat constipation or diarrhea promptly to reduce strain on the rectum.
